摘要: 许多研究人员认为人们是以事件为单位来体验和认识世界的。以动词为核心的事件,把实体概念有机地联系、组织起来,在丰富实体概念间静态联系的同时,也构成了用以表示动态过程的基本单元。但是,事件知识却不容易从文本中直接获取。提出了一个以一个事件作为核心挖掘与之相关联的事件的方法。该方法在充分利用句法分析的基础之上,从二元词语扩展到语义更丰富的多个词语,挖掘到了相关的事件短语。在此基础上,机器标注了事件短语的人物角色,最终发现了相关事件与核心事件间的角色联系。实验结果显示,提出的方法从受限的文本语料里得到了大量的相关事件和角色联系,并取得了较高的准确率。

Abstract: Many researchers hold this option that event accords with human normal cognitive rules and is the basic unit of human cognition. It is event which uses a verb as event core that constitutes the basic unit of dynamic process description while putting the entity concepts into organic links and organization to enrich static contact between them. But knowledge of event can not easily and directly acctuire from text. A method based on one event as core event to mine events which arc associated with the core event was proposed. It acquired associated event's chunks by extend binary words to multiple more semantic words on the basis of the full use of parsing, and then tagged role of the event's chunk and finally discovered roles relationship between of associated event and core event. The experimental results show that the proposed method has acquired considerable associated events and roles relationships from restricted corpus and has achieved a higher precision.
